What is "tragicomedy"?

Tragicomedy is a genre that blends elements of both tragedy and comedy, creating a story that features serious, often sorrowful themes alongside moments of humor and lightheartedness. This genre explores complex emotions and situations, mixing dramatic and comic elements to provide a detailed and layered portrayal of life. The aim of tragicomedy is to reflect the complexities of human experience, showing how joy and sorrow can coexist and interact in real life.
